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from Fabro to Rimini is to bus which costs €23 - €40 and takes 7h 17m.
The fastest way to get from Fabro to Rimini is to drive which takes 2h 56m and costs €30 - €45.
No, there is no direct bus from Fabro to Rimini. However, there are services departing from Fabro and arriving at Rimini via Fabro Scalo and Perugia.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 7h 17m.
The distance between Fabro and Rimini is 360 km. The road distance is 195.2 km.
The best way to get from Fabro to Rimini without a car is to train via Bologna which takes 5h 21m and costs €40 - €160.
It takes approximately 5h 21m to get from Fabro to Rimini, including transfers.
Fabro to Rimini bus services, operated by Busitalia Umbria, depart from Fabro Scalo station.
The best way to get from Fabro to Rimini is to train via Bologna which takes 5h 21m and costs €40 - €160. Alternatively, you can bus, which costs €23 - €40 and takes 7h 17m.
Fabro to Rimini bus services, operated by Busitalia Umbria, arrive at Fontivegge station.
Yes, the driving distance between Fabro to Rimini is 195 km. It takes approximately 2h 56m to drive from Fabro to Rimini.
